What Is the 2-Hour Experienced Renewal?

Instead of the standard 4 hours of continuing education, qualifying experienced operators complete a shorter 2-hour renewal each cycle. Who Qualifies?

The reduced option is intended for operators who meet TDLR's experienced-operator criteria. Eligibility is based on how long you've held your license and your renewal history. Because the exact criteria can change, the simplest way to confirm is to check your TDLR renewal notice or your account — it will indicate whether you're eligible for the reduced requirement.

  • Intended for long-licensed, experienced operators
  • Eligibility is shown on your TDLR renewal notice
  • When in doubt, the standard 4-hour course always satisfies the requirement

What Does the 2-Hour Course Cover?

Even at 2 hours, the course keeps what matters most:

  • Texas cosmetology law update — key rules and scope-of-practice reminders.
  • Sanitation and disinfection — the same core health-and-safety content as the 4-hour course, because Texas requires it.
